The ingredients for this Caesar Club Sandwich from Food Network, really appealed to me. The traditional caesar all crammed into delicious ciabatta bread. This is the first time that I have prepared a dressing using anchovy paste and I was interested to see how the flavour would differ to anchovies in oil.
I gave this recipe a fabulous 8/10!
Ingredients
Chicken breasts, Olive oil, Pancetta, Garlic, Parsley, Anchovy paste, Dijon mustard, Lemon juice, Mayonnaise, Ciabatta bread, Rocket, Sun-dried tomatoes, Parmesan 8/10
Level of difficulty
The recipe is very simple, you could probably make the dressing without a food processor, but it is smoother if you use one. 8/10
Time taken to prepare
There is quite a bit of prep for this dish, but most of the ingredients that need to be cooked, can be prepared simultaneously. I used boneless chicken breast, which didn’t take as long to cook as the recipe suggests. 7.5/10
The food
This caesar club sandwich is packed with fabulous flavours. The dressing is really tasty, it could probably have done with being a little bit thicker. The flavours in the dressing were quite zesty and the anchovy paste seemed to add a slightly more smoky flavour than anchovy fillets. The pancetta and chicken work really well together and the flavours complimented each other. The sun-dried tomatoes were strong, but as long as you enjoy their flavour, they are great in this dish. The parmesan and rocket add a final caesar twist to this club. I used individual ciabatta, which were lovely and fresh. They were quite small and with hindsight a bigger loaf might have worked better, to contain all the fabulous ingredients. 8.5/10
Overall
I thought this sandwich was amazing. From the lovely fresh ciabatta, to the intense sun-dried tomatoes and the salty pancetta, every mouthful was a flavour packed winner. I will definitely be trying this again and this recipe deserves the very high rating of 8/10.
